Transaction 29e366c0423e13d0257c78c32d22a83b5d1b804e21bde8de1649d7c4df723fd4
1 Input
2 Outputs
- 29e366c0423e13d0257c78c32d22a83b5d1b804e21bde8de1649d7c4df723fd4:0
- 29e366c0423e13d0257c78c32d22a83b5d1b804e21bde8de1649d7c4df723fd4:1
value 20000000
address 3EeU9aJVL2GnLHLNFvQSHG5MnUjsGZJun7
value 1954350
address 17Fkkwxgjb8DrvBAyYq5F8RUkCHn8iJqew